Browse Source

Merge pull request #37047 from YeldhamDev/tabcontainer_doc_control_fix

Fix incorrect TabContainer documentation for 'get_tab_control()'
Rémi Verschelde 5 years ago
parent
commit
51d86c9112
2 changed files with 3 additions and 3 deletions
  1. 2 2
      doc/classes/TabContainer.xml
  2. 1 1
      scene/gui/tab_container.cpp

+ 2 - 2
doc/classes/TabContainer.xml

@@ -36,10 +36,10 @@
 		<method name="get_tab_control" qualifiers="const">
 		<method name="get_tab_control" qualifiers="const">
 			<return type="Control">
 			<return type="Control">
 			</return>
 			</return>
-			<argument index="0" name="idx" type="int">
+			<argument index="0" name="tab_idx" type="int">
 			</argument>
 			</argument>
 			<description>
 			<description>
-				Returns the currently visible tab's [Control] node.
+				Returns the [Control] node from the tab at index [code]tab_idx[/code].
 			</description>
 			</description>
 		</method>
 		</method>
 		<method name="get_tab_count" qualifiers="const">
 		<method name="get_tab_count" qualifiers="const">

+ 1 - 1
scene/gui/tab_container.cpp

@@ -990,7 +990,7 @@ void TabContainer::_bind_methods() {
 	ClassDB::bind_method(D_METHOD("get_current_tab"), &TabContainer::get_current_tab);
 	ClassDB::bind_method(D_METHOD("get_current_tab"), &TabContainer::get_current_tab);
 	ClassDB::bind_method(D_METHOD("get_previous_tab"), &TabContainer::get_previous_tab);
 	ClassDB::bind_method(D_METHOD("get_previous_tab"), &TabContainer::get_previous_tab);
 	ClassDB::bind_method(D_METHOD("get_current_tab_control"), &TabContainer::get_current_tab_control);
 	ClassDB::bind_method(D_METHOD("get_current_tab_control"), &TabContainer::get_current_tab_control);
-	ClassDB::bind_method(D_METHOD("get_tab_control", "idx"), &TabContainer::get_tab_control);
+	ClassDB::bind_method(D_METHOD("get_tab_control", "tab_idx"), &TabContainer::get_tab_control);
 	ClassDB::bind_method(D_METHOD("set_tab_align", "align"), &TabContainer::set_tab_align);
 	ClassDB::bind_method(D_METHOD("set_tab_align", "align"), &TabContainer::set_tab_align);
 	ClassDB::bind_method(D_METHOD("get_tab_align"), &TabContainer::get_tab_align);
 	ClassDB::bind_method(D_METHOD("get_tab_align"), &TabContainer::get_tab_align);
 	ClassDB::bind_method(D_METHOD("set_tabs_visible", "visible"), &TabContainer::set_tabs_visible);
 	ClassDB::bind_method(D_METHOD("set_tabs_visible", "visible"), &TabContainer::set_tabs_visible);